Scope of the Role:
Reporting to the Director of Care - Administration, the
Quality Improvement Manager
leads our internal Quality Improvement Program, co-chairs Quality Team Meetings, and supports the Resident Quality Inspection process (RQI). This role fosters a culture of safety, accountability, and continuous improvement across the Home.
Key Responsibilities
Coordinate the Continuous Quality Improvement Program and RQI process
Lead internal Quality Team Meetings and staff training on RQI
Develop and submit the Annual HQO Quality Improvement Plan
Monitor and analyze quality indicators, trends, and performance outcomes
Communicate Quality Improvement initiatives to Residents' and Family Council
Collaborate with Accreditation Coordinator to meet CARF standards
Ensure compliance with quality, safety, and risk management standards
Qualifications:
Risk management certification is an asset
IDEAS and Lean Six Sigma (any colour belt) preferred.
Strong knowledge of healthcare practices, trends, and issues in LTC
Proven management experience in long-term care
Expertise in Quality and Risk Management programs
Knowledge of Resident Quality Inspection (RQI) under the FLTCA and its Regulations
Knowledge of RAI-MDS 2.0 and/or LTCF and CIHI indicators
Strong communication, leadership, and team-building skills
Positive, people-focused approach with commitment to resident dignity.
InterRAI long-term care facility (LTCF) assessment
Current Vulnerable Sector Check, TB test, immunization records, and two supervisory references required
French language is an asset
